Output 612b51906d72d91c4655f5fc71f955d3c37bc512381fc3bb8a5c5dd2215f1cdb:0

value
269000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bff5986126eb3e429fe6ec1f69fddd3a21ca23a OP_EQUAL
address
3MkFoZc27c6Ympypkia4P22eEdPzgkSqTx
transaction
612b51906d72d91c4655f5fc71f955d3c37bc512381fc3bb8a5c5dd2215f1cdb
spent
true